Plasma concentrations (μmol/L) of total homocysteine and phosphatidylcholine in pre-menopausal women (n=43) stratified by phosphatidylethanolamine N-methyltransferase (PEMT) G5465A and G-744C genotypes as well as methylenetetrahydrofolate dehydrogenase (MTHFD1) G1958A genotype at baseline (Wk 0) and after 7-wk of folate restriction (Wk 7)ac

Metabolite
Homocysteine Phosphatidylcholine
Gene Wk 0 Wk 7 Change Wk 0 Wk 7 Change
 PEMTG5465A
  GG, n=3 5.1 ± 0.3 6.4 ± 0.5 1.3 ± 0.3yz 1863 ± 89 1680 ± 137 −183 ± 224
  GA, n=19 5.6 ± 0.2 6.9 ± 0.2 1.3 ± 0.1y** 1866 ± 90 1712 ± 88 −154 ± 38
  AA, n=21 5.5 ± 0.2 7.6 ± 0.3 2.1 ± 0.2z 1821 ± 80 1703 ± 66 −117 ± 50
 PEMTG-744C
  GG, n=9 5.3 ± 0.3 7.3 ± 0.4 2.0 ± 0.3 1863 ± 133 1660 ± 103 −203 ± 73y*
  GC, n=17 5.8 ± 0.2 7.6 ± 0.3 1.8 ± 0.2 1783 ± 86 1620 ± 77 −163 ± 59y+
  CC, n=17 5.4 ± 0.1 6.8 ± 0.3 1.4 ± 0.2 1895 ± 89 1814 ± 83 −80 ± 40z
 MTHFD1G1958A
  GG, n=9 5.5 ± 0.2 7.0 ± 0.3 1.5 ± 0.2y+ 1679 ± 104 1597 ± 102 −82 ± 72
  GA, n=21 5.6 ± 0.2 7.1 ± 0.3 1.6 ± 0.2y* 1930 ± 85 1756 ± 82 −174 ± 51
  AA, n=13 5.5 ± 0.3 7.5 ± 0.4 2.0 ± 0.3z 1818 ± 92 1699 ± 73 −119 ± 45
a

Data are presented as mean ± standard error of the mean.

b

The women consumed 350 mg/d of choline throughout the study.

c

The data were analyzed using the general linear model procedure with the difference (ie, change) between wk 0 and wk 7 for folate restriction and wk 7 and 14 for folate treatment (data not shown) as the response variable. The independent variables included PEMT G5465A genotype, MTHFR C677T genotype and baseline measures (i.e., wk 0 for folate restriction). All possible interactions were included in the model and post-hoc analyses with multiple comparisons were employed for the purposes of mean separation. For the PEMT G5465A genotype, an additional analysis was performed after combining the carriers of the G allele. Values in a column with different superscript letters are indicative of differences,

*

for P<0.05,

**

for P<0.01; or trends,

+

P<0.1, relative to homozygous variant genotype. For PEMT G5465A, differences (P=0.001) were detected between carriers of the G allele and the AA genotype.
